Due to the fact the product list was too long and I couldn't post on the pic: Eyebrows: I used eyelure brow pomade in No.10 with nyx brow mascara to set in dark brown. I concealed using mac select cover up in NW20. Eyes: I used a few shades as the base and to build up the colour from the morphe 35O palette. for the glitter I used eyelash glue to apply Lit glitters in rhinestone cowboy. In the waterline I used a NYX blue liner with kiko eyeshadow in blue to set. The mascara is L'Oréal telescopic (best mascara I've ever used) Face: I primed using Nivea men's post shave balm and used Armani luminous silk in the darkest shade (not sure off the top of my head the number) I contoured using ABH powder contour and used mac select cover up again to contour the lighter parts and set with Rimmel match perfection translucent powder. I used MUA highlighter in iridescent gold to highlight (only £3!) Lips: mac soar lip liner, Rimmel matte liquid in nude flush and guerlain lip gloss 463 on top. Then NYX matte finish spray to set!!

I'm sorry to hear that you feel that way. I have been the exact same as you and I was almost considering dropping out, but I emailed my lecturers at uni and explained to them what was happening as my attendance was low at university and I have been missing assignment deadlines. My uni really helped me and they referred me to the uni councillor and they are also setting up a support plan due to my mental health which they allow me to have extra time for assignments and exams, one to one tuition, a separate room during exams with regular rest breaks and also someone to help explain questions to me so I have just as much as an equal chance like the students without mental health issues. It's honestly took a weight off my shoulders as I just didn't think I could make it through uni but honestly they have put my mind at ease. I seriously urge you to speak to your own personal doctor and the university to see what they can offer. My uni also offers counselling (I am from the uk, but I'm sure most Unis elsewhere will offer similar services) but it's worth it to speak to someone and see what help there is. Don't suffer in silence and I hope you get better
